get_portfolio_performance

Read-onlyIdempotent

Get portfolio performance data with returns and benchmark comparisons for any time period.

Instructions

Get portfolio performance data including returns, benchmarks, and performance metrics.

Retrieves comprehensive performance metrics for your portfolio including returns, benchmarks, and performance comparisons over the specified time period.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
date_rangeNoTime range for performance data. Options: 1d, 1w, 1m, 3m, 6m, 1y, 2y, 5y, maxmax
